Alice Cooper, Johnny Depp, Joe Perry Supergroup Announce First Live Dates

By RTTNews Staff Writer   ✉   | Published:   | Follow Us On Google News

Hollywood Vampires, a new supergroup featuring Johnny Depp, Alice Cooper and Joe Perry, have announced their first ever live dates.

The first performances will take place at the Roxy in Los Angeles on September 16th and 17th. It will be the group's only U.S. show. Cooper guitarist Tommy Henriksen will also be playing at the show as will bassist Bruce Witkin. The group has also planned an appearance in Brazil on September 24th as part of the Rock in Rio festival. Prior to that show, the band is teaming with the Starkey Hearing Foundation to help fit 150 people in need with hearing aids and bring some of the fans to the show so they can hear music for the first time.

Former Guns N Roses members Duff McKagan and Matt Sorum round out the band.

The band will release their self-titled debut album on September 11.
